    Yes, you can take admission this year in BA (Hons.) courses like Political Science, History, Philosophy, or Sociology at Midnapore College (Autonomous) without having studied Mathematics in Class 12, as these programs don't require it. However, for B.Sc. courses like Computer Science, Electronics, or Statistics, Mathematics in Class 12 is mandatory for eligibility.

    Yes, you can apply for certain undergraduate courses at Midnapore College (Autonomous) even if you haven't studied Mathematics in your Class 12th. The college offers Bachelor of Science (General) programs in subjects like Botany, Zoology, Physiology, Microbiology, and Nutrition, where Mathematics is not a mandatory requirement. These courses typically require you to have studied Biology and Chemistry, with a minimum aggregate of forty-five percent marks in your qualifying examination.
